Job Title: Service Coordinator/Housing Navigator

Reports To: Senior Coordinator/ Manager of Interim Scooter and Service Coordination/Site Manager

Classification: Nonexempt

Job Description

This position is responsible for the planning, execution, and review of services provided to the clients of HCEB. They handle complaints and questions of clients and report to their immediate supervisor.

Duties and Responsibilities
  • Assist participants with the housing application process, coordinatehealthand housing services, and provide tenancy sustaining services
  • Initiate andmaintainpositive working relationships with local private and nonprofit landlords
  • Maintainaccurateprogram participant files, current housing inventory, and provide weekly program participant updates
  • Maintain regular contact with other tenant support staff and address any issues arising from those conversations, in conjunction with property management staff
  • Perform housing outreach and administrative tasks, and halimbawa participate in trainings and meetings
  • Coordinate with the finance department to track program participant's Housing Financial Assistance accounts
  • Support residents who become delinquent in rent payments or receive other lease warnings from property management; support residents and their support staff insubmittingmaintenance work orders to property management
  • Participate in regular check-in property management staff to review resident red flags
  • Community-building activities
  • Maintain professionalism, discretion, and independent judgment with clients
  • Ensure participant’s document-readiness
  • Encode service notes and housing related expenses into HMIS database
  • Support participants in lease ups;
    Request for flex funds to pay security deposit and first month’s rent and other housing related fees
  • Assist participants in applying for rental/ move-in subsidies
  • Facilitate regular community meetings at each property
  • Perform other duties as assigned

Qualifications
  • Associate degree required/Bachelor’sdegree preferred
  • History of progressively responsible related work experience, preferably in a non-profit organization, minimum of 2 years
  • Experience supporting homeless adults with disabilities, minimum of 2 years
  • Experience working as part of a dynamic, multi-disciplinary team
  • Strong record-keeping skills
  • Able to pass a fingerprint background check
  • Excellent PC skills, including word-processing and spreadsheets in a Windows-type environment
  • Knowledge of Clarity/HMIS/Coordinated entry assessments information
  • Ability to work in outdoor settings/various weather conditions
  • Results-oriented and able to meet deadlines
  • Excellent interpersonal and customer service skills
  • Flexible and self-motivated with an ability to coordinate and prioritize workload
  • Interest in growing with the agency, progressively assuming more responsibility
  • High standard of excellence and quality
  • Sensitivity and respect towards the individuals we serve
  • Driver License
